Local Food Sources Rich in Vitamin B12

A balanced diet is essential for maintaining adequate vitamin B12 levels. Residents of Kidderminster can enhance their nutritional intake by:

  • Incorporating lean meats such as chicken and beef into their meals.
  • Including fish varieties like salmon and trout.
  • Utilising dairy products like milk and cheese for additional sources.
  • Exploring fortified cereals and plant-based alternatives for those following a vegan diet.

Making these dietary adjustments can greatly reduce the risk of deficiency and promote overall health. Local markets and grocery stores provide a variety of these food options, empowering residents to make informed choices that boost their vitamin B12 intake.

Adjusting Medications Before Testing

Discussing any necessary medication adjustments with your GP in Kidderminster is essential prior to undergoing a vitamin B12 blood test. Certain medications, such as proton pump inhibitors or metformin, can hinder vitamin B12 absorption and potentially skew test results.

Your healthcare provider can advise on whether temporary changes are necessary. This collaborative approach ensures that test results accurately reflect your vitamin B12 status, aiding informed treatment decisions.

Commonly Asked Questions

What does a vitamin B12 blood test involve?

A vitamin B12 blood test measures the level of vitamin B12 in your bloodstream, assisting in the identification of deficiencies that could lead to various health issues.

Why is vitamin B12 essential?

Vitamin B12 is vital for red blood cell production, neurological function, and DNA synthesis. A deficiency can result in fatigue, memory problems, and other serious health concerns.

How can I determine if I need a vitamin B12 test?

If you experience symptoms such as fatigue, weakness, or memory issues, or if you follow a vegetarian or vegan diet, consult your GP about the need for testing.

Where can I get a vitamin B12 blood test in Kidderminster?

You can access a vitamin B12 blood test at local GP surgeries, clinics, or through accredited home testing services available in Kidderminster.

What should I do if my test results show a deficiency?

If your test results indicate a deficiency, consult your GP for treatment options, which may include dietary changes, supplements, or injections.

Are there risks associated with the blood test?

The vitamin B12 blood test is generally considered safe, with minimal risks. Some patients may experience slight discomfort or bruising at the site of the blood draw.

How often should I be tested for vitamin B12 levels?

The frequency of testing is based on individual risk factors. Your GP can suggest an appropriate schedule according to your health status and dietary habits.

Can I take supplements prior to the test?

It is recommended to avoid vitamin supplements for at least 24 hours before the test, as they may affect the accuracy of the results.

What dietary changes can help improve my vitamin B12 levels?

Incorporating foods such as lean meats, fish, dairy products, and fortified cereals can help boost your vitamin B12 intake.

Is home testing for vitamin B12 reliable?

Home testing can be dependable if conducted by accredited providers. Ensure you carefully follow the instructions for the most accurate results.
